Skip to content

Commit 926ec34

Browse files
committed
test: ✅ fix jest spy
1 parent 301ef9c commit 926ec34

File tree

21 files changed

+57
-37
lines changed

21 files changed

+57
-37
lines changed

apps/401-recipe-filter-solution/src/app/recipe/recipe-filter.spec.ts

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,7 @@
11
import { outputBinding } from '@angular/core';
22
import { render, screen } from '@testing-library/angular';
33
import userEvent from '@testing-library/user-event';
4+
import { createSpy } from '@whiskmate/testing/create-spy';
45
import { RecipeFilterCriteria } from './recipe-filter-criteria';
56
import { RecipeFilter } from './recipe-filter.ng';
67

@@ -20,7 +21,7 @@ describe(RecipeFilter.name, () => {
2021
});
2122

2223
async function mountRecipeFilter() {
23-
const filterChangeSpy = vi.fn();
24+
const filterChangeSpy = createSpy();
2425

2526
await render(RecipeFilter, {
2627
bindings: [outputBinding('filterChange', filterChangeSpy)],

apps/401-recipe-filter-starter/src/app/recipe/recipe-filter.spec.ts

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,13 +1,14 @@
11
import { outputBinding } from '@angular/core';
22
import { render, screen } from '@testing-library/angular';
33
import userEvent from '@testing-library/user-event';
4+
import { createSpy } from '@whiskmate/testing/observe';
45
import { RecipeFilter } from './recipe-filter.ng';
56

67
describe(RecipeFilter.name, () => {
78
it.todo('🚧 triggers filterChange output');
89

910
async function mountRecipeFilter() {
10-
const filterChangeSpy = vi.fn();
11+
const filterChangeSpy = createSpy();
1112

1213
await render(RecipeFilter, {
1314
bindings: [

apps/402-recipe-search-filter-interaction-solution/src/app/recipe/recipe-filter.spec.ts

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,7 @@
11
import { outputBinding } from '@angular/core';
22
import { render, screen } from '@testing-library/angular';
33
import userEvent from '@testing-library/user-event';
4+
import { createSpy } from '@whiskmate/testing/create-spy';
45
import { RecipeFilterCriteria } from './recipe-filter-criteria';
56
import { RecipeFilter } from './recipe-filter.ng';
67

@@ -20,7 +21,7 @@ describe(RecipeFilter.name, () => {
2021
});
2122

2223
async function mountRecipeFilter() {
23-
const filterChangeSpy = vi.fn();
24+
const filterChangeSpy = createSpy();
2425

2526
await render(RecipeFilter, {
2627
bindings: [outputBinding('filterChange', filterChangeSpy)],

apps/402-recipe-search-filter-interaction-starter/src/app/recipe/recipe-filter.spec.ts

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,7 @@
11
import { outputBinding } from '@angular/core';
22
import { render, screen } from '@testing-library/angular';
33
import userEvent from '@testing-library/user-event';
4+
import { createSpy } from '@whiskmate/testing/create-spy';
45
import { RecipeFilterCriteria } from './recipe-filter-criteria';
56
import { RecipeFilter } from './recipe-filter.ng';
67

@@ -20,7 +21,7 @@ describe(RecipeFilter.name, () => {
2021
});
2122

2223
async function mountRecipeFilter() {
23-
const filterChangeSpy = vi.fn();
24+
const filterChangeSpy = createSpy();
2425

2526
await render(RecipeFilter, {
2627
bindings: [outputBinding('filterChange', filterChangeSpy)],

apps/403-recipe-search-add-button-solution/src/app/recipe/recipe-filter.spec.ts

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,7 @@
11
import { outputBinding } from '@angular/core';
22
import { render, screen } from '@testing-library/angular';
33
import userEvent from '@testing-library/user-event';
4+
import { createSpy } from '@whiskmate/testing/create-spy';
45
import { RecipeFilterCriteria } from './recipe-filter-criteria';
56
import { RecipeFilter } from './recipe-filter.ng';
67

@@ -20,7 +21,7 @@ describe(RecipeFilter.name, () => {
2021
});
2122

2223
async function mountRecipeFilter() {
23-
const filterChangeSpy = vi.fn();
24+
const filterChangeSpy = createSpy();
2425

2526
await render(RecipeFilter, {
2627
bindings: [outputBinding('filterChange', filterChangeSpy)],

apps/403-recipe-search-add-button-starter/src/app/recipe/recipe-filter.spec.ts

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,7 @@
11
import { outputBinding } from '@angular/core';
22
import { render, screen } from '@testing-library/angular';
33
import userEvent from '@testing-library/user-event';
4+
import { createSpy } from '@whiskmate/testing/create-spy';
45
import { RecipeFilterCriteria } from './recipe-filter-criteria';
56
import { RecipeFilter } from './recipe-filter.ng';
67

@@ -20,7 +21,7 @@ describe(RecipeFilter.name, () => {
2021
});
2122

2223
async function mountRecipeFilter() {
23-
const filterChangeSpy = vi.fn();
24+
const filterChangeSpy = createSpy();
2425

2526
await render(RecipeFilter, {
2627
bindings: [outputBinding('filterChange', filterChangeSpy)],

apps/404-recipe-filter-material-solution/src/app/recipe/recipe-filter.spec.ts

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,7 @@
11
import { outputBinding } from '@angular/core';
22
import { render, screen } from '@testing-library/angular';
33
import userEvent from '@testing-library/user-event';
4+
import { createSpy } from '@whiskmate/testing/create-spy';
45
import { RecipeFilterCriteria } from './recipe-filter-criteria';
56
import { RecipeFilter } from './recipe-filter.ng';
67

@@ -20,7 +21,7 @@ describe(RecipeFilter.name, () => {
2021
});
2122

2223
async function mountRecipeFilter() {
23-
const filterChangeSpy = vi.fn();
24+
const filterChangeSpy = createSpy();
2425

2526
await render(RecipeFilter, {
2627
bindings: [outputBinding('filterChange', filterChangeSpy)],

apps/404-recipe-filter-material-starter/src/app/recipe/recipe-filter.spec.ts

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,7 @@
11
import { outputBinding } from '@angular/core';
22
import { render, screen } from '@testing-library/angular';
33
import userEvent from '@testing-library/user-event';
4+
import { createSpy } from '@whiskmate/testing/create-spy';
45
import { RecipeFilterCriteria } from './recipe-filter-criteria';
56
import { RecipeFilter } from './recipe-filter.ng';
67

@@ -20,7 +21,7 @@ describe(RecipeFilter.name, () => {
2021
});
2122

2223
async function mountRecipeFilter() {
23-
const filterChangeSpy = vi.fn();
24+
const filterChangeSpy = createSpy();
2425

2526
await render(RecipeFilter, {
2627
bindings: [outputBinding('filterChange', filterChangeSpy)],

apps/501-recipe-preview-ct-solution/src/app/recipe/recipe-filter.spec.ts

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,7 @@
11
import { outputBinding } from '@angular/core';
22
import { render, screen } from '@testing-library/angular';
33
import userEvent from '@testing-library/user-event';
4+
import { createSpy } from '@whiskmate/testing/create-spy';
45
import { RecipeFilterCriteria } from './recipe-filter-criteria';
56
import { RecipeFilter } from './recipe-filter.ng';
67

@@ -20,7 +21,7 @@ describe(RecipeFilter.name, () => {
2021
});
2122

2223
async function mountRecipeFilter() {
23-
const filterChangeSpy = vi.fn();
24+
const filterChangeSpy = createSpy();
2425

2526
await render(RecipeFilter, {
2627
bindings: [outputBinding('filterChange', filterChangeSpy)],

apps/501-recipe-preview-ct-starter/src/app/recipe/recipe-filter.spec.ts

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,7 @@
11
import { outputBinding } from '@angular/core';
22
import { render, screen } from '@testing-library/angular';
33
import userEvent from '@testing-library/user-event';
4+
import { createSpy } from '@whiskmate/testing/create-spy';
45
import { RecipeFilterCriteria } from './recipe-filter-criteria';
56
import { RecipeFilter } from './recipe-filter.ng';
67

@@ -20,7 +21,7 @@ describe(RecipeFilter.name, () => {
2021
});
2122

2223
async function mountRecipeFilter() {
23-
const filterChangeSpy = vi.fn();
24+
const filterChangeSpy = createSpy();
2425

2526
await render(RecipeFilter, {
2627
bindings: [outputBinding('filterChange', filterChangeSpy)],

0 commit comments

Comments
 (0)